How to Find the Source of a Leaking Roof Before the Damage Spreads

A leaking roof can be misleading. Water appearing on a ceiling may suggest that the defect is directly above the damp patch, but roof leaks do not always behave so simply. Once water enters the roof construction, it can travel along underlay, timbers and other surfaces before becoming visible elsewhere inside the property.

How Do You Identify Where a Roof Leak Is Coming From?

Finding a roof leak requires more than looking for the most obvious damaged component. The internal evidence, external roof covering, junctions, flashing, valleys and previous repair areas may all provide useful clues.

The objective is to work backwards from where moisture has appeared and establish how it entered the roofing system. Once the source is understood, repairs can be focused on the actual defect before continued water ingress affects a wider area.

Start With Where the Water Becomes Visible

The first clue is usually the location where moisture appears inside the property.

This could be a damp ceiling patch, discolouration, water within the roof space or moisture around a particular junction. Recording where the problem occurs can help narrow down the investigation.

However, this location should be treated as a starting point rather than proof of where the roof has failed.

Water may have travelled before becoming visible, meaning the external defect could be some distance away.

The Internal Damp Patch May Not Be Directly Below the Leak

One of the most important things to understand about roof leaks is that water can move.

After passing through the outer roof covering, moisture may run along the underside of roofing materials or follow structural components before dripping onto the ceiling below.

This can create considerable separation between the entry point and the visible stain.

Repairing the roof immediately above an internal damp patch without further investigation can therefore result in the genuine source being overlooked.

Inspecting the Roof Space Can Provide Valuable Clues

Where the roof space can be assessed appropriately, it may reveal evidence that cannot be seen from the rooms below.

Water staining, dampness or marks along timbers can sometimes indicate the direction from which moisture has travelled. The condition of the underlay and surrounding materials may provide additional clues.

Older water marks should also be distinguished from active moisture where possible.

The aim is to establish a likely route rather than assuming that every stain identifies the current entry point.

Follow Moisture Back Towards Its Highest Point

Because water generally travels downwards after entering the roof, tracing signs of moisture towards their highest visible point can help narrow down the likely source.

For example, staining may extend along a timber before reaching an area where the roof covering or junction above requires closer examination.

This process needs careful interpretation.

The highest visible internal mark is not necessarily the exact external defect, but it can provide a useful direction for further assessment.

Check for Slipped or Missing Roof Tiles

Displaced roof tiles are among the more recognisable causes of water ingress.

A tile may have slipped partially out of position without disappearing completely. Even a relatively small movement can alter the intended overlap within the roof covering.

Missing tiles create a more obvious opening.

Where either problem is present, the surrounding tiles and fixings should also be checked. It is important to establish whether the movement is isolated or part of a wider pattern of deterioration.

Cracked Tiles Can Allow Water Through Without Looking Dramatic

A roof tile does not need to be missing to create a potential weakness.

Cracks can sometimes be difficult to identify from ground level, particularly when they are narrow or located within a less visible part of the roof. The tile may still appear to be sitting correctly alongside neighbouring materials.

Look Beyond the Tiles Themselves

A common mistake when diagnosing a pitched roof leak is concentrating exclusively on the roof tiles.

Tiles form an important weathering layer, but water can also enter around the numerous junctions and details incorporated into a roof.

A roof may have no missing tiles while still developing a leak.

The complete affected area therefore needs to be considered, including flashing, valleys, ridges and other points where different roof components meet.

Flashing Is a Common Area to Investigate

Flashing protects vulnerable roof junctions and transitions.

If it becomes displaced, lifted or deteriorated, water can enter around the adjoining materials even when the surrounding roof covering remains intact.

Leaks associated with flashing can sometimes be mistaken for tile problems because the internal damp patch appears beneath a tiled section.

Careful inspection of the relevant junction can help establish whether the tiles are actually responsible or whether the weakness lies elsewhere.

Roof Valleys Need Particular Attention

Valleys carry water from adjoining roof slopes and can therefore handle considerable quantities of rainfall.

A defect within a valley can allow moisture to enter the roof construction, while debris or deterioration may affect how effectively water moves through the area.

Because water is deliberately concentrated into a valley, relatively small weaknesses can become important.

When internal moisture corresponds with an area close to a valley, the complete valley detail and neighbouring roof covering should be assessed.

Ridge Areas Can Also Develop Defects

The ridge is exposed to weather and forms an important junction at the upper part of a pitched roof.

Movement, cracking or deterioration around ridge components can create potential routes for moisture. Water entering high on the roof may then travel before becoming visible considerably lower down.

This can make the resulting leak difficult to diagnose from the internal stain alone.

A complete inspection should therefore consider defects above the apparent leak area rather than examining only the same horizontal position.

Consider Whether Wind-Driven Rain Changes the Pattern

Some roof leaks appear only during particular weather conditions.

Ordinary rainfall may cause no visible problem, while rain accompanied by strong wind produces an internal damp patch. This can indicate that water is being driven beneath or around a vulnerable detail from a particular direction.

The timing of the leak can therefore provide useful diagnostic information.

Knowing whether it appears during every rainfall or only under certain conditions can help narrow down the possible source.

A Leak After Prolonged Rain Can Suggest a Different Pattern

Some defects become noticeable only after the roof has been exposed to rain for an extended period.

Rather than producing immediate dripping, moisture may gradually penetrate a vulnerable area until enough has accumulated to become visible internally.

More Than One Defect May Be Contributing

Roof leak diagnosis is not always a matter of finding one single opening.

An older roof can sometimes contain several relatively small defects. Moisture entering through different points may then follow similar routes before becoming visible within the same general internal area.

Repairing only one defect may consequently improve the problem without eliminating it completely.

A thorough assessment should consider the wider condition of the affected roof section rather than stopping as soon as the first possible cause is discovered.

The Condition of the Underlay Can Matter

The outer roof covering provides the primary weathering surface, but the materials beneath also form part of the overall roofing system.

Where water passes beneath tiles, the condition of the underlay can influence how that moisture behaves. It may direct water towards another location or, where deterioration is present, allow moisture to pass further into the roof construction.

This is another reason why the internal leak location can be misleading.

The complete route between the external covering and the internal damp area may need to be understood.

Damp Timbers Can Reveal the Direction of Water Travel

Roof timbers can sometimes show staining or dampness where moisture has travelled along their surfaces.

Following these marks can help identify whether the water originated higher up the roof slope or near a particular junction.

However, historic staining can remain after an earlier leak has been repaired.

Professional assessment helps distinguish between evidence of previous moisture and indications that water is currently entering the roof.

Why Finding the Source Early Matters

Continued water ingress can affect more than the original point of entry.

Moisture may spread across underlay, insulation, timbers and internal finishes before becoming obvious. The longer the defect remains unresolved, the greater the area that may be exposed to repeated dampness.

Early diagnosis can help keep the roofing repair focused.

Where the underlying defect remains localised and surrounding materials are sound, addressing it promptly may prevent a relatively contained problem from developing into more extensive deterioration.

Signs That a Roof Leak Needs Prompt Investigation

Professional assessment is worthwhile when you notice:

  • new damp patches on ceilings;
  • water staining within the roof space;
  • moisture appearing after rainfall;
  • leaks that occur mainly during wind-driven rain;
  • a damp patch that becomes larger after prolonged wet weather;
  • slipped, missing or cracked roof tiles;
  • deterioration around flashing or roof junctions;
  • signs of moisture around valleys;
  • recurring leaks after previous repairs;
  • several damp areas appearing within the same part of the property.

These symptoms can have different causes, which is why diagnosis should come before deciding on the repair.

A Localised Leak Does Not Automatically Mean Widespread Roof Failure

Discovering water inside a property can understandably raise concerns about the condition of the entire roof.

However, many leaks originate from a relatively contained defect. A slipped tile, damaged junction or localised area of deterioration may be repairable where the surrounding roof remains in good condition.

Equally, repeated leaks across several areas can indicate that the problem is broader.

The extent of work should therefore be determined by the actual roof condition rather than assuming either a minor repair or complete replacement before an assessment has been carried out.
